Tag: cws_src680_dba24
User: oj      
Date: 05/02/27 23:36:59

Modified:
 /dba/dbaccess/source/ui/dlg/
  detailpages.cxx

Log:
 #i43622# correct suppress version column

File Changes:

Directory: /dba/dbaccess/source/ui/dlg/
=======================================

File [changed]: detailpages.cxx
Url: 
http://dba.openoffice.org/source/browse/dba/dbaccess/source/ui/dlg/detailpages.cxx?r1=1.34&r2=1.34.4.1
Delta lines:  +11 -5
--------------------
--- detailpages.cxx     21 Jan 2005 17:15:13 -0000      1.34
+++ detailpages.cxx     28 Feb 2005 07:36:56 -0000      1.34.4.1
@@ -2,9 +2,9 @@
  *
  *  $RCSfile: detailpages.cxx,v $
  *
- *  $Revision: 1.34 $
+ *  $Revision: 1.34.4.1 $
  *
- *  last change: $Author: kz $ $Date: 2005/01/21 17:15:13 $
+ *  last change: $Author: oj $ $Date: 2005/02/28 07:36:56 $
  *
  *  The Contents of this file are made available subject to the terms of
  *  either of the following licenses
@@ -566,7 +566,7 @@
                        }
 
                        if ( (m_nControlFlags & 
CBTP_USE_SUPPRESS_VERSION_COLUMN) == CBTP_USE_SUPPRESS_VERSION_COLUMN )
-                               
m_pSuppressVersionColumn->Check(pSuppressVersionColumn->GetValue());
+                               m_pSuppressVersionColumn->Check( 
!pSuppressVersionColumn->GetValue() );
 
                        if ( (m_nControlFlags & CBTP_USE_ENABLEOUTERJOIN) == 
CBTP_USE_ENABLEOUTERJOIN )
                                
m_pEnableOuterJoin->Check(pEnableOuterJoin->GetValue());
@@ -652,7 +652,13 @@
                        
fillBool(_rSet,m_pIgnoreDriverPrivileges,DSID_IGNOREDRIVER_PRIV,bChangedSomething);
 
                if ( (m_nControlFlags & CBTP_USE_SUPPRESS_VERSION_COLUMN) == 
CBTP_USE_SUPPRESS_VERSION_COLUMN )
-                       
fillBool(_rSet,m_pSuppressVersionColumn,DSID_SUPPRESSVERSIONCL,bChangedSomething);
+        {
+            if( (m_pSuppressVersionColumn != NULL) && 
(m_pSuppressVersionColumn->GetState() != 
m_pSuppressVersionColumn->GetSavedValue()) )
+                   {
+                           _rSet.Put(SfxBoolItem(DSID_SUPPRESSVERSIONCL, 
!m_pSuppressVersionColumn->IsChecked()));
+                           bChangedSomething = sal_True;
+                   }
+        }
 
                if ( (m_nControlFlags & CBTP_USE_ENABLEOUTERJOIN) == 
CBTP_USE_ENABLEOUTERJOIN )
                        
fillBool(_rSet,m_pEnableOuterJoin,DSID_ENABLEOUTERJOIN,bChangedSomething);




---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]

Reply via email to